The polypeptide chains present in insulin is connected by _______ bonds. Correct Answer disulphide

The polypeptide chains present in insulin is connected by disulphide bonds. These disulphide bonds are formed between two cysteine residues. In total insulin consists of 3 disulphide bonds.
